Warning Signs You Need Crawl Space Water Extraction

Crawl space water extraction can be a costly and time-consuming process if left unaddressed. But, by catching the warning signs early, you can prevent further damage and save money in the long run. Here are some common warning signs that you need crawl space water extraction: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a musty smell in your crawl space that won’t go away, it’s likely a sign of water damage. Our team can help you identify the source of the odor and provide a customized solution to remove it.

Water Stains on Your Walls

If you notice water stains on your walls, it’s a sign that there’s water damage in your crawl space. Our team can help you identify the source of the water and provide a customized solution to repair the dam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

If you notice warped or buckled flooring in your crawl space, it’s a sign that there’s water damage. Our team can help you identify the source of the water and provide a customized solution to repair the damage.

Standing Water in Your Crawl Space

If you notice standing water in your crawl space, it’s a sign that there’s a serious issue that needs attention. Our team can help you identify the source of the water and provide a customized solution to extract the water and dry out the affected area.

Water Damage in Your Insulation

If you notice water damage in your insulation, it’s a sign that there’s a serious issue that needs attention. Our team can help you identify the source of the water and provide a customized solution to repair the damage.

Crawl Space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Water damage in a small area (less than 10 sq. Ft.) Yes No You can likely handle this yourself with basic equipment and knowledge.
Water damage in a large area (more than 10 sq. Ft.) No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are required to handle this situation safely and effectively.
Standing water in the crawl space No Yes This is a serious issue that needs immediate attention to prevent further damage and health risks.
Water damage in insulation No Yes This needs specialized equipment and expertise to repair safely and effectively.
Water damage in a confined space (e.g., crawl space) No Yes This needs specialized equipment and expertise to handle safely and effectively.
Water damage in a area with sensitive equipment (e.g., electrical) No Yes This needs specialized equipment and expertise to handle safely and effectively.

With crawl space water extraction, it’s often better to err on the side of caution and call a professional. DIY tries can lead to further damage, health risks, and costly repairs down the line.

Crawl Space Water Extraction Cost in Rio Rico, AZ

The cost of crawl space water extraction in Rio Rico, AZ, varies dep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team provides free estimates to help you understand the cost involved.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and equipment required.
Insulation repair and replacement $1,000 – $5,000 Size of the affected area, type of insulation, and labor required.
Structural repair and restoration $2,000 – $10,000 Size of the affected area, type of materials, and labor required.
Dehumidification and air purification $500 – $2,000 Size of the affected area, type of equipment, and labor required.
Disinfection and sanitization $200 – $1,000 Size of the affected area, type of disinfectants, and labor required.
Water damage restoration and repair $1,000 – $5,000 Size of the affected area, type of materials, and labor required.
